Associate Director/Director Immunology Pharmacodynamic Biomarkers

The Department of Early Development Pharmacokinetics, Pharmacodynamics and Bioanalytical Sciences is a Translational Pharmacology group dedicated to helping to translate novel research discoveries into effective therapeutics for unmet medical needs. An important part of our success is the use of relevant and novel PD-biomarkers to help drive our decision making on which drugs to bring forward and how to dose them appropriately. We are currently looking for a highly skilled and passionate leader of our Immunology Pharmacodynamic Biomarkers group. The successful candidate will lead a large group of talented scientists and research associates to successfully integrate PD-Biomarkers strategies and assays into our preclinical and clinical development programs in the areas of Immunology, Infectious
Diseases, Neurology, Tissue Growth and Repair. He/She will provide scientific leadership for the company's efforts to develop PD-biomarker strategies and novel assays to determine drug MOA, activity and relevant biological effects in patients. This candidate will be expected to form close collaborations with our Research Discovery, Diagnostics, Clinical ITGR, Safety and PKPD groups.
